WHY JAP STARTED
Since childhood, Marcus has been passionate about running and athletics, achieving success in junior sports with numerous accolades in football and track and field. At 15, he began weightlifting without proper guidance, and by 17, noticed a decline in his football performance, compounded by persistent lower back pain, which led to a waning interest in pursuing his AFL dreams.
A decade later, at 26, he made a return to playing his best football with four years of hypertrophy training. This sparked a deeper journey into athlete training for peak performance, leading him to Melbourne for coaching in human movement and biomechanics, and Ludus Sports Performance in Perth, where he refined skills in speed, strength, endurance, and agility. His search for knowledge, inspired by lingering back pain, led to an in-depth study of human anatomy, especially the pelvis. This solidified his belief that athletes require a strong foundation of balance, posture, and biomechanics. After earning his Certificate 4 in Exercise Fitness, he launched Jackson Athletic Performance to impact aspiring athletes in the South West.

We will work with the athlete's schedule as to what days they will train and program it in individual to their situation. We will also advise on what other parts of their schedule we would recommend removing or rearranging to help get them from where they are to where they want to be, this is just advice and up to the athlete's discretion. In the off-season new athletes will start on 3 sessions per week and will have to earn the right to receive a more comprehensive program by hitting 85% or above of their program.

Absolutely not! We still develop and progress our athletes during all times of the year. The in season period is the perfect time to get in some solid ground work focussing on low fatigue areas such as stability, core strength, imbalances, niggles and injury so when the off-season period does hit, we can hit the ground running!
